classeme

From Wiktionary, the free dictionary

English

[edit]

Etymology

[edit]

Fromclass +‎-eme.

Noun

[edit]

classeme (pluralclassemes)

  1. (semiotics) Ageneric orcontextualseme, denoting a group of objects.
    • 1986,Umberto Eco,Semiotics and the Philosophy of Language[1],→ISBN, page190:
      Given that "bark" has twoclassemes, human and canine, it is the presence of the dog or the commissioner that decides whether "bark" is taken in a literal or figurative sense.
